Add 20/63 and 14/27
20/63 + 14/27 is 158/189.
Steps for adding fractions
- Find the least common denominator or LCM of the two denominators:
LCM of 63 and 27 is 189
Next, find the equivalent fraction of both fractional numbers with denominator 189 - For the 1st fraction, since 63 × 3 = 189,
20/63 = 20 × 3/63 × 3 = 60/189 - Likewise, for the 2nd fraction, since 27 × 7 = 189,
14/27 = 14 × 7/27 × 7 = 98/189 - Add the two like fractions:
60/189 + 98/189 = 60 + 98/189 = 158/189 - So, 20/63 + 14/27 = 158/189
